[Building Sakai] sakai-2.8.0-rc01 available (use Tomcat 5.5.33)

Anthony Whyte arwhyte at umich.edu
Thu Feb 24 10:11:03 PST 2011

The sakai-2.8.0-rc01 release candidate is now available.  QA admins supporting the 2.8 release should provision their servers with the new tag at their earliest convenience as another test fest will be held on Friday, 25 Feb. 2011.


svn co https://source.sakaiproject.org/svn/sakai/tags/sakai-2.8.0-rc01/


2.8.x has been branched to a 2.8.0 branch in order to prep for the final release.  This includes updating pom versions for "non-indie" projects such as assignments, osp and rwiki from 2.8-SNAPSHOT to 2.8.0.  

The two branches are sync'd as of r89041.  From this point onwards, 2.8.x will begin to diverge from the 2.8.0 release branch since only release blockers will be merged from trunk to the latter branch.  The 2.8.x branch poms will continue to be versioned as 2.8-SNAPSHOT for the life of the branch, per current Sakai versioning conventions.  The final release will be cut from the 2.8.0 release branch.

Indie releases such as basiclit, msgcntr, profile2 and samigo utilize the Maven release plugin to generate their releases and do not require separate release branches.


Please deploy this tag to Tomcat 5.5.33.



The sakai-2.8.0-rc01 demo *.zip/tar.gz archives include Tomcat 5.5.33.

cd sakai-2.8.0-rc01
mvn -Ppack-demo install

Generated demo archives will be found here: sakai-2.8.0-rc01/pack/pack-demo


1. Site caching: https://jira.sakaiproject.org/browse/KNL-652

Site caching is not working properly and appears to be an issue of long standing, affecting the Sakai CLE from version 2.5.0 onwards.  A fix has been provided by the University of Michigan and is in production at UCT.  However, the kernel team is divided on whether or not the the fix should be applied so late in the kernel-1.2.0/sakai-2.8.0 release cycle.  As a result the fix is not included in rc01 although it could be applied to later pre-release tags or bumped to 2.8.1.  

Production data relative to the fix is rather thin at present.  UCT has been running the code in production for approximately 10 days with no reported negative effects but is currently unable to ascertain if the patch actually addresses the caching issues.  The University of Michigan is at present not in a position to provide useful test results on their patch before the end of March.

2. Hibernate index generation failures; example: https://jira.sakaiproject.org/browse/PRFL-546

Hibernate 3.2.7.ga stubbornly refuses to generate defined indexes for auto-generated (auto.ddl=true) 2.8.0 databases.  This is not new to 2.8.  Seth and I have also noticed instances where Hibernate also ignores column NOT NULL attributes.  I plan to create a supplementary conversion script that will include at a minimum the missing index statements.

3. Conversion scripts: https://jira.sakaiproject.org/browse/SAK-19088 

The conversion scripts require a final round of testing.

4.  Post-2.80-rc01 fixes: https://jira.sakaiproject.org/secure/IssueNavigator.jspa?mode=hide&requestId=12536

These fixes were committed after sakai-2.8.0-rc01 was tagged.

5. 2x open blockers: https://jira.sakaiproject.org/secure/IssueNavigator.jspa?mode=hide&requestId=12708

Note: only SAK-19945, SAK-19088 (both conversion script testing tickets) and POLLS-137 (discovered late last night) are items of interest.

6. 2x open critical tickets: https://jira.sakaiproject.org/secure/IssueNavigator.jspa?mode=hide&requestId=12709

TAG INFO (Indie versions, 2.8 team leads).



8/9 March 2011 (if necessary)


31 March 2011 (tentative)



-------------- next part --------------
A non-text attachment was scrubbed...
Name: smime.p7s
Type: application/pkcs7-signature
Size: 3829 bytes
Desc: not available
Url : http://collab.sakaiproject.org/pipermail/sakai-dev/attachments/20110224/809df4bf/attachment.bin 

More information about the sakai-dev mailing list